Lingchen Wang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Lingchen Wang has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 584 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Molecular Biology, 9 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 7 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Lingchen Wang's work include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(6 papers), Advancements in Battery Materials (5 papers) and Ophthalmology and Eye Disorders (4 papers). Lingchen Wang is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(6 papers), Advancements in Battery Materials (5 papers) and Ophthalmology and Eye Disorders (4 papers). Lingchen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Egypt. Lingchen Wang's co-authors include Chunlin Chen, Jian Zhang, Soliman I. El-Hout, Bin Zhu, Jie Yang, Christopher S. von Bartheld, Chen Wang, Zhaoyin Wen, Yan Lü and Chaoyang Ye and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Advanced Functional Materials.
